    We put chicken wire around young plants that the animals eat until they are robust enough to not be affected by animals. It has helped our hostas , my young rose bush, and some young Hollys in our yard. If you plant sunflowers again maybe put a barrier around them until they are bigger

    The fuchsia probably just needs consistent water and some fertilizer. The leaf browning/yellowing is from improper care. Most likely too much direct hot sun also. I’d baby it for a few weeks and see before I cut it back. That much budding, flowering and growth takes lots of water and nutrients from the soil. Your yard is looking lovely! 😊

Also, my mom is 87 and has been an VERY active gardner all her life. Her tip for hanging baskets is to fill a bucket full of water and let the basket sit in the bucket. It needs to suck water up from the roots. Leave it in the bucket for a couple of hours and I do that twice a month. When it is extremely hot we do that once a week. I am telling you your hanging baskets will be so full and healthy looking, give it a try. I live in northern Ontario. Hugs xoxo

    I see squirrels as rats with fluffy tails. They will eat bird eggs from nests and young birds. We have a battery operated feeder that spins squirrels off. Also, baffles are inexpensive deterrents that go onto poles. Try mixing cayenne pepper in with feed. Supposedly doesn't bother birds, but squirrels won't like it. Good luck! Love the flower beds!

When I planted catnip, my friend, shawne taught me to plant a birdcage or something similar a little below the service of the dirt and the plant inside it. Then cats/ any other wildlife can only eat the plant down to the edge of the cage and they can’t get any further inside.
